Asset Registry

Understanding the Liquid Asset Registry

Intermediate

The Liquid Asset Registry

With the ability to create unlimited custom assets on Liquid, a critical question arises: how do users know which assets are legitimate? The Liquid Asset Registry solves this problem by providing a trusted source of information about assets issued on the Liquid Network.

The registry helps prevent fraud and confusion by allowing users to verify asset details before engaging in transactions.

Purpose of the Asset Registry

Asset Verification

The primary purpose of the registry is to verify the authenticity of assets. Since Liquid asset IDs are long hexadecimal strings, it's difficult for users to verify legitimacy just by looking at an ID. The registry connects these IDs to real-world entities.

Preventing Fraud

Without a registry, bad actors could create assets with names identical to legitimate assets, potentially tricking users into accepting counterfeit tokens. The registry helps prevent such impersonation.

Discovery

The registry provides a central place to discover legitimate assets on the Liquid Network, making it easier for users to find tokens they might be interested in.

How the Asset Registry Works

The Liquid Asset Registry operates on a few key principles:

  1. Domain Verification - Assets can be associated with a domain name that the issuer controls, providing a simple way to verify legitimacy.
  2. Public Database - The registry is a public database that anyone can query to get information about registered assets.
  3. Metadata - Asset issuers can provide metadata like logos, descriptions, and links to further information.
  4. Integration - Wallets and exchanges can integrate with the registry to automatically display verified information about assets.

A Note from Satoshi

While the Asset Registry helps with verification, users should always conduct their own research before transacting with any asset. The registry provides information, but doesn't guarantee the value or legitimacy of any particular asset's use case.

Registering an Asset

If you're an asset issuer, you can register your asset by following these steps:

  1. Issue your asset on the Liquid Network
  2. Set up a domain verification file on a website you control
  3. Submit your asset details to the registry
  4. Wait for verification, which typically involves checking your domain proof
  5. Once verified, your asset will appear in the public registry

The domain verification is especially important as it creates a link between your digital asset and a real-world entity that users can recognize and trust.

Asset Management

Asset ManagementAsset Registry
Intermediate
Complete verification first